Her favourite type of enrichment though was undoubtedly scent enrichment.  Whatever the scent, Petra wasn’t fussy.  Spices, perfumes, scented oils, all of these were heaven for Petra and as soon as she discovered them, she would immediately start to rub her head and her cheeks all over them, rolling, dribbling, in absolute heaven, and a definite break from the usually very regal looking lady that we have all known her to be.  Petra was always well presented, keeping herself very prim and immaculate.  She even changed colour throughout the year form a deep terracotta colour in the summer to a frosty grey in the winter.  She really was a sight to see.

As she grew older, Petra would enjoy the quieter things in life, an evening asleep in her outside shelter, soaking up the sun in the summer evening light.  Eyes shut, body totally stretched out and relaxed.  For the last few years of her life, we had reason to believe that she was almost completely deaf, but this never bothered her. It just meant she could doze in her sun trap, totally undisturbed. Her loss of hearing never seemed to change her behaviour, she continued to be totally comfortable in her surroundings and with her keepers, behaving with the endless patience and grace that she had always shown us.
